Terrence Jones (born January 24, 1992) is an American professional basketball player who has competed at the highest levels of the sport, including stints in the NBA with teams like the Houston Rockets, Brooklyn Nets, and others. Standing 6'9", Jones is known for his versatility on both ends of the court, with particular strength in defense and rebounding. He was drafted in the 2012 NBA Draft and has had a lengthy professional career spanning multiple continents, including successful seasons in international leagues. Jones' athleticism and defensive capabilities made him a valuable contributor to NBA teams during his tenure in the league.
